Latest Patents

Morikawa's latest patents include a push button switch and a keyboard switch assembly. The push button switch features a key top, dome section, and leg section that are integrally formed from silicone rubber material. This design allows for increased manufacturing efficiency and greater design freedom. The key top includes a colored section created by penetrating dye into the silicone rubber, enhancing its aesthetic appeal. The keyboard switch assembly is designed for electronic instruments and includes a printed circuit board with fixed contact points and a movable contact sheet. This innovative design allows for easier assembly and increased productivity, as the movable contact points do not require exact positioning to function effectively.
